Output 77d4f31dbfb2bdf9001710d38c15116f2d97d6d338b490f6992080c9f027e2a7:64

value
5049093
script pubkey
OP_HASH160 OP_PUSHBYTES_20 139bb26864ffafdf032c0f0c2e1aabc4d8d64076 OP_EQUAL
address
33UhHCWGrghnvr6tuuyJDB8ekvF8ssDJ5P
transaction
77d4f31dbfb2bdf9001710d38c15116f2d97d6d338b490f6992080c9f027e2a7
spent
true